General Summary
Support the UK Ad Sales team in driving revenue for Discovery Networks UK from advertising, partnerships and digital campaigns with top UK advertisers, both directly with media agencies and via our Advertising Sales Representatives Sky Media, Channel 4 and Mean Broadcast. Primarily responsible for supporting the team in the management and proposal of brand partnerships and advertising campaigns across multiple platforms including on-air, digital, social.
Responsibilities
● Assisting in the management of campaigns by supporting Executives, Managers and Directors with day-to-day campaign management and getting campaigns live
● Maintain weekly sales pipeline documents by working closely with the team
● Support in brief responses with creative ideas and the use of industry research software (TechEdge, TGI, Tubular)
● Creation and monthly maintenance of sales collateral including Flyers, Sales Decks any ad hoc decks
● Responsible for brand partnership team comms including collating and distributing newsletters, LinkedIn & Instagram and keeping contact databases up to date (ALF)
● Identifying new opportunities for Discovery to drive incremental revenue, including creating hit-lists of target brands
● Work with on-air and digital inventory management to understand and manage advertising inventory availability across platforms
● Present to the team market/client/ internal information to help the development of future business
● Reporting and data input including monthly reports, post campaign analysis and ad hoc requests
● Creation of case studies on past successful partnerships and advertising campaigns
● Support Executives, Managers and Directors in maintaining relationships with all media agencies and advertising sales representatives at Sky, Channel 4 and Mean Broadcast
● Build strong inter-departmental relationships throughout Discovery
● Attend internal meetings, training and presentations and where appropriate, industry events & seminars, and provide written feedback for the team
